    Laying brick pavers on tarmac or concrete?

    Postby SandMan » Mon May 07, 2007 4:19 pm

    Just wondered what people's thoughts are on this subject, if the tarmac or concrete doesn't have any cracks or holes in and is virtually water tight after many years of being used would you recommend lay brick pavers on it?

    In my past experience I have experienced that even after the pavers dry out after laying them in the rain or rains before you can get your kiln dry sand in place, the sand you lay them on (Seen before on a sloping driveway) comes up further down the driveway through the pavers whilst being wacked even though you have kiln dried it, as anyone else experienced this and though twice about laying them on such solid foundation that is water tight?

    Never experienced any problems laying pavers on a solid base as long as they are laid to a slope themselves for the water to run off.
